We use parents as much as they want to. We are diligent to make sure they don't help just to watch their own child, but they can be in any role within our ministry. I try to lean on them because ultimately I am here to aid them in helping raise a spiritually mature student.

I have a few parents that are involved, but most of my parents do not get involved. Often when we do a trip in the summer to a theme park or a trip of that nature, I will get some parents that will volunteer to drive and if I need a sponsor for a weekend event, I will get a few to go with me.

As far as planning, parents do not help plan. They just let me and our staff do the planning.

Parents play a large part of the ministry here. It varies though...they can be as involved as they want to be. From Special Event Chaperones to Small Group Leaders/Sunday School Teachers. I meet with most of the parents that are somewhat interested. The "drop and dash" parents we minister to the family, but as leadership and involvement we look for commitment and by-in to what we have going on. I welcome all input from parents, both negative and positive. I have found that even in angry parents complaints there is truth that can be addressed (hopefully in a healthy way :). I have seen some great success in events that have been planned and executed by parents/adults, i allow that type of freedom...sometimes risky, but a huge plus.
